Overview


TA module


Type II Classification (family/domain) vapBC/PHD-PIN
Location 3826252..3826958 Replicon chromosome
Accession NC_000962
Organism Mycobacterium tuberculosis H37Rv

Toxin (Protein)


Gene name vapC Uniprot ID P9WF49
Locus tag Rv3408 Protein ID NP_217925.1
Coordinates 3826548..3826958 (+) Length 137 a.a.

Antitoxin (Protein)


Gene name vapB Uniprot ID P9WF23
Locus tag Rv3407 Protein ID NP_217924.1
Coordinates 3826252..3826551 (+) Length 100 a.a.
